The fourth … thof-500e cableWebSecond, carbon dioxide can bind to plasma proteins or can enter red blood cells and bind to hemoglobin. This form transports about 10 percent of the carbon dioxide. When carbon dioxide binds to hemoglobin, a molecule called carbaminohemoglobin is formed. Binding of carbon dioxide to hemoglobin is reversible. thoeurn indyWebJul 8, 2015 · Hemoglobin is an iron-containing oxygen transport metalloprotein in the red blood cells of most mammals.
